HX55 AOC is a 2005 Fiat Hymer in Grey with a 2,800c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2005 Fiat Hymer models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.5% with a typical mileage of 42,947 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Hymer fails its MOT is headlamp aim beam image kick up to the offside, accounting for 531 recorded failures. If you're considering buying HX55 AOC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Hymer typically stays on UK roads for around 40 years. At 21 years old, this Fiat Hymer is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
